
Incredibles 3 is speeding into theaters.
Fans can look forward to Incredibles 3, the next chapter in Pixar’s popular animated superhero series about the Parr family. The movie was officially announced at D23 in 2024, over five years after Incredibles 2 came out. While Brad Bird, who directed the first two films, wrote the story, Peter Sohn – known for directing Elemental – will be directing this installment.
Pixar has officially announced that Incredibles 3 will hit theaters on June 16, 2028. That’s almost exactly ten years after Incredibles 2 premiered on June 15, 2018. They shared the news on X (formerly Twitter) along with a look at the movie’s logo.
